Description
Classic Joan Miro design vase, there is a white clay spot on the bottom typical for Artigas marking, additional signed in clay letters "C" and "G" -- a typical signature mark by Joan Gardy Artigas.
The vase comes from local estate auction. The authenticity is not documented.

This small vase is a complex elaborate artwork: the brown lines of the design are drawn deepened into wet un-fired clay, the segments between the lines are filed with color glazes. The entire vase is over-coated with additional clear glaze.

The vase is 5.1/4" [13.3cm] tall, c.3" [7.6cm] at the widest; 1.1/4" [4.5cm] across at the bottom and c.1.3/8" [c.4cm] across at the top, fine condition.

Joan Gardy Artigas (born 1938) is a Catalan ceramist, artist and was a close collaborator with Joan Miro.

Artigas was born in Boulogne-Billancourt (near Paris). His father was Josep Llorens Artigas who worked closely with Miro and Pablo Picasso, because of this relationship Artigas, still a teenager, was able to work for Miro. Artigas trained at the Ecole des Beaux Arts in Paris where he met the Swiss sculptor Alberto Giacometti. Artigas established his own studio where at Giacometti's suggestion he concentrated on sculpture. Artigas had some success and supplied his expertise to the cubists Georges Braque and Marc Chagall.Artigas created the 7,200 tiles for the Miro Wall. He coloured the tiles based on an image which Miro had created. The artwork includes the signatures of both artists. Artigas' signature is dated 1979. When his father retired, Artigas returned to assist Miro.

Artigas continued his own art and he was awarded his first solo exhibition in America in 1982. He has been a visiting artist at two American universities and he has founded a foundation to celebrate his father's work. Gardy-Artigas serves on the board of the foundation Fundacia Joan Miro in Barcelona.
